Disability Shower Installation in Nashua, NH
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ible and safe bathing spaces for individ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These projects typically involve replacing existing showers with barrier-free or walk-in designs, installing grab bars, non-slip flooring, and other supportive features that enhance independence and safety. Property owners often seek these services to modify existing bathrooms or to design new accessible showers that accommodate specific needs, ensuring ease of use and compliance with safety considerations.
Before requesting disability shower install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of modifications, the types of accessible shower options available, and any structural or plumbing adjustments that may be necessary. It's important to consider the specific mobility requirements, space constraints, and aesthetic preferences to ensure the finished installation meets both safety standards and personal comfort. Clear communication about these factors can help facilitate a smooth process and a functional, accessible bathing area.

Disability Shower Installation Questions
What types of disability showers are available for installation? There are various options including walk-in showers, roll-in showers, and accessible shower stalls designed for safety and ease of use.
Can existing bathrooms be modified for disability shower installation? Yes, many bathrooms can be adapted with modifications such as installing grab bars, low-threshold entryways, and non-slip flooring.
What should property owners consider before installing a disability shower? It’s important to evaluate space requirements, plumbing configurations, and accessibility features to ensure proper functionality and safety.
Are there specific features that enhance safety in disability showers? Features like grab bars, seating options, and non-slip surfaces help improve safety and accessibility in the shower area.
